Ease restrictions on production, processing and sale of hemp
Closed
45 signatures
What the petition asks
1. Allow farmers to process CBD oil from the hemp plants flower and leaf
2. Reclassify hemp as a crop and allow a free market on hemp products and production
3. Get rid of the licenses currently needed to grow hemp
4. Consider the restrictions on THC levels dependant on weather

It cannot be right that farmers can grow hemp and then be forced to compost the most profitable parts; the flowers and leaf.
Hemp is currently classified as a drug and needs a licence to grow. This is so off putting to farmers that we barely grow 900 hectares of hemp.
Hemp contains some THC, and the % is subject to the weather, and this should be factored into rules limiting the allowable % of THC in hemp.
